Rock My Heart is an 8-year-old bay gelding from New Zealand, trained by R & R Rogers in Cambridge. He is the offspring of the stallion Shocking and the mare Attraction. Throughout his career, Rock My Heart has secured 3 victories. His most notable win occurred on November 27, 2021, at Te Aroha, where he was ridden by Lynsey Satherley and triumphed in the $45,000 Bm65 Handicap, defeating James Barrie. He has been a profitable horse for bettors over time, yielding a 1 percent return on investment for those who supported him during his career.
